RAF flies £950m unfrozen cash assets to Libya




The RAF is flying £950m of Libyan cash to Libya after an assets freeze aimed at Col Muammar Gaddafi was lifted.
Notes, amounting to 1.86 billion Libyan dinars that were printed in the England, this cash has been given to Libya's Central Bank.
A White-house said the money would be available to load into cash machines and distribute to Libyan banks  very quickly.
The cash was released following a decision by the United Nations sanctions committee in New York
